    Regarding working with MacOS, the BLE-Stack is officially supported only on Windows. However, users have been able to install and use it on other OS. Please see this FAQ post on the BLE forum and this MacOS CCSv6 page for tips on installing and using BLE-Stack on MacOS. Please note that the wiki page was written for an older version of CCS and BLE-Stack so some details may need to be tweaked but the overall steps/tips should be valid.

    Then I recognized that CC2650 Sensortag Project disappeared from Resource Explorer.

    The CC2650 package that was in Resource Explorer was a pretty outdated version. It was removed to avoid confusion and keep users on the latest version. You can download and install the latest version from http://www.ti.com/tool/ble-stack.
